Winning numbers drawn for $910M Mega Millions jackpot (7/28/2023)

Feeling lucky? Unfortunately, most of America will have to return to work next week as Friday's Mega Millions drawing yielded no jackpot winners. 

Below were the winning numbers for the top prize, which at the time was $940 million:

5, 10, 28, 52, 63 and the Mega Ball number being 18. Megaplier 5x

The jackpot will be bumped up just over $1 billion next week as the nation awaits the jackpot winner.

HOW MUCH DO YOU WIN AFTER TAXES?

There are 910 millions reasons to dream, especially what you would do with the jackpot money. However, one thing all lottery winners have to take into account is the fact that their prizes will be taxed.

So how much do you really get after taxes?

It depends on a couple of factors: do you have to pay state taxes where you live? Will you take the lump sum payment or the annuity payout?

According to Mega Millions' website, those electing to take the annuity option get one immediate payment followed by 29 annual payments, a process that is identical to Powerball with their payouts.
